Dhan Khera - Ramgarh, Alwar

Dhan Khera is a village situated in the Ramgarh tehsil of Alwar district, Rajasthan. It is located approximately 15 km from the tehsil headquarters in Ramgarh and around 22 km from the district headquarters in Alwar. Jatpur serves as the Gram Panchayat for Dhan Khera village.

As per Census 2011, the village code of Dhan Khera is 072657. The village covers a total geographical area of 241 hectares and falls under the 301026 pincode. Alwar is the nearest town, located about 22 km away.

Dhan Khera village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Sarpanch serving as the elected head.

Population of Dhan Khera

According to the 2011 Census, Dhan Khera village had a total population of 497 people, including 260 males and 237 females, living in 87 households. The sex ratio was 912 females per 1,000 males. The overall literacy rate was 75.72%, with male literacy at 84.58% and female literacy at 66.34%. The Scheduled Caste (SC) population was 17, while the Scheduled Tribe (ST) population was 211.

Transport and Connectivity of Dhan Khera

Public transport facilities are available within 2-5 km of the Dhan Khera. The nearest railway station is Mahwa, while the nearest airport is Jaipur International Airport, situated at an approximate aerial distance of 96.5 km.
